But as Johnson departs, Sam Gyimah, MP for East Surrey, arrives in his place. Mr Gyimah, 바카라사이트 now former prisons minister,?is no stranger to 바카라사이트 Department for Education, having served as a parliamentary under-secretary of state in 바카라사이트 department between 2015 and 2016. He is a?former investment banker (Goldman Sachs), and he (surprise surprise) read politics, philosophy and economics ¨C you guessed it ¨C 바카라사이트?University of Oxford, where he was also president of 바카라사이트 Oxford Union.

After his appointment was confirmed, we asked 온라인 바카라's followers what issues 바카라사이트y think Mr Gyimah should place at 바카라사이트 top of his ministerial agenda, using 바카라사이트 hashtag . Unsurprisingly, 바카라사이트re was no shortage of suggestions.
One issue raised was 바카라사이트 inclusion of international students in net migration figures for 바카라사이트 UK. Surely students studying here shouldn't count towards migration figures (meaning that if fewer students come it equates to progress towards 바카라사이트 government's aim to cut immigration)?
It should be noted that while this is a longstanding bone of contention within higher education, this is actually an issue for 바카라사이트 Home Office (which can actually remove students from such figures). However, it seems that many in 바카라사이트 sector are keen to make sure that 바카라사이트 new universities minister is aware of this vital issue.

The recent drop off in 바카라사이트 number of part-time and mature students studying in 바카라사이트 UK was also an issue that a number of tweeters wanted to see tackled. Former universities minister David Willetts has conceded that it was an unforeseen consequence of his tuition fee reforms, but what might 바카라사이트 new minister do to address this hot topic?

O바카라사이트rs took a look at previous headlines made by Mr Gyimah, including his part in allegedly scuppering 바카라사이트 progress of a new law to pardon all gay and bisexual men in England and Wales historically convicted of sexual offences that are no longer criminal when, during his time as justice minister, he spoke for such a period of time that 바카라사이트 bill could not progress. He argued at 바카라사이트 time that 바카라사이트 proposed law did not give strong enough protections against men being accidentally pardoned for sex with a minor or non-consensual sex.

Update (11 January 2018): reaction from sector bodies
Maddalaine Ansell, chief executive,?University Alliance:?
¡°Sam Gyimah takes on 바카라사이트 role at an important juncture. His top priority is likely to be getting 바카라사이트 best deal for higher education and research in 바카라사이트 Brexit negotiations. The government¡¯s promised ¡®major review¡¯ into tertiary education also looms large ¨C this must address 바카라사이트 decline in mature and part time learners and ensure that 바카라사이트 gains in HE participation in recent years are not undermined. ?
"Technical education is likely to remain high on 바카라사이트 government¡¯s agenda ¨C to give technical and professional education 바카라사이트 recognition and prestige it deserves, it is important that those taking this route are able to pursue 바카라사이트ir studies at graduate and postgraduate level. It is a credit to Jo Johnson that he oversaw a boost to 바카라사이트 science and innovation budget, and we hope that this will remain a priority for 바카라사이트 minister.¡±?
?
Dave Phoenix, chair of MillionPlus and vice-chancellor of London South Bank University:
¡°A good place to start would be with 바카라사이트 clear recognition and reaffirmation that 바카라사이트 strength of UK higher education lies in its diversity and 바카라사이트 quality of 바카라사이트 sector's contribution to teaching, research and innovation. Modern universities are especially prevalent in terms of flexible learning for all, widening access and engagement with employers and SMEs. We¡¯ve long held 바카라사이트 view that 바카라사이트 government¡¯s goals on skills, productivity, regional growth and social mobility can only be met by fully embracing what modern universities have to offer.
?"The sector will always seek to fur바카라사이트r improve but as 바카라사이트 UK repositions post Brexit, championing universities and students is 바카라사이트 only way to help 바카라사이트 sector truly thrive in 바카라사이트 years ahead.¡±
?
Sally Hunt, general secretary of 바카라사이트 University and College Union:
¡°He will of course have a busy in-tray and we are happy to work with people who are keen to defend our universities and colleges.¡± Ms Hunt said she ¡°hoped he will be able to give details of what form 바카라사이트 government¡¯s major review of university funding will take and that he and new education secretary Damian Hinds will look again at 바카라사이트 make-up of 바카라사이트 board of 바카라사이트 Office for Students.¡±?
?
Dame Janet Beer, president of Universities UK and vice-chancellor of 바카라사이트 University of Liverpool:
The ¡°promised review of tertiary education funding in England and establishing 바카라사이트 new regulatory framework and Office for Students will likely be top of 바카라사이트 new minister's in-tray,¡± said Dame Janet.
¡°Improving post-study work visas for international students, supporting universities¡¯ role in promoting social mobility and securing our long-term participation in 바카라사이트 European programmes Horizon 2020 and Erasmus+ should also be priorities."
